‘Amazing player’ – Anthony Elanga not surprised by rise of Manchester United starlet

Nottingham Forest attacker Anthony Elanga is not surprised by the rise of Kobbie Mainoo in the Manchester United first-team.

Mainoo seized the opportunity to star in the Reds’ midfield while Casemiro was out with a hamstring injury, between November and January, but the pair have recently formed a solid partnership in the middle of the pitch.

Erik ten Hag’s side have won five of the six games Casemiro and Mainoo have started together, and the Reds face Nottingham Forest and Man City later this week.

Elanga, who left United to join Forest in the summer, still talks to the 18-year-old regularly and has spoken to The Times about his breakthrough season.

“He’s an amazing player and a top person and I just want him to keep doing what he’s doing because the sky’s the limit for him,” Elanga said. “I’m not surprised at all. I saw it when I was playing with him in the academy for the Under-19s Youth League. Those that have a real eye, they’ll know he plays the same as he did in the academy. Obviously he’s had to adapt but he still plays the same playing style.”

Speaking about how difficult it was to leave United in the summer, Elanga added: “It was difficult [to leave] but it was needed because I wanted to play and I didn’t want to spend another season just playing 10 minutes or not playing for 10 games. I wanted a fresh start but I knew it wouldn’t be easy leaving a club that I had been at for nine years.”

Elanga has become a key player at Forest this season.
